What is Decision Artificial Intelligence?
Okay, so what exactly is decision artificial intelligence? Simply put, it's using AI technologies to automate or enhance decision-making processes. Think of it as having a super-smart assistant who can analyze tons of data, spot patterns, and suggest the best course of action – all in the blink of an eye. These AI systems use algorithms, machine learning models, and data analytics to make informed choices with minimal human intervention.
Decision AI comes in many forms, including rule-based systems that follow a set of predefined rules, machine learning models that learn from data, and optimization algorithms that find the best solution among many possibilities. These systems can be used in a variety of applications, such as financial trading, medical diagnosis, and supply chain management. For example, in finance, AI can analyze market trends to make trading decisions, while in healthcare, it can help doctors diagnose diseases more accurately. How Does It Work?
So, how does decision AI actually work its magic? It all starts with data. AI algorithms need vast amounts of information to learn and identify patterns. This data can come from various sources, such as historical records, real-time feeds, and sensor data. Once the data is collected, it's preprocessed and cleaned to ensure its quality and relevance.
Next, machine learning models are trained on this data. These models learn to recognize patterns and relationships, which they use to make predictions or recommendations. For example, a model might learn to predict customer behavior based on their past purchases and browsing history. The key is to train the models with relevant data that accurately reflects the real-world scenarios in which the decisions will be made. This training process involves feeding the model data and adjusting its parameters until it can accurately predict outcomes. The more data the model is trained on, the better it becomes at making accurate predictions and informed decisions. This iterative learning process is what makes decision AI so powerful. Furthermore, the algorithms used in decision AI are designed to optimize decision-making. Optimization algorithms evaluate different possible solutions and select the one that best meets the defined objectives. These algorithms can take into account multiple constraints and trade-offs, ensuring that the decisions made are both effective and efficient. The combination of machine learning and optimization algorithms allows decision AI to make complex decisions in a dynamic and uncertain environment, providing a significant advantage in various industries. Real-World Applications
Let's look at some cool real-world applications of decision AI. In healthcare, AI is being used to diagnose diseases, personalize treatment plans, and predict patient outcomes. Imagine an AI system that can analyze medical images and identify cancerous tumors with greater accuracy than human radiologists. That's the power of decision AI in action!
In finance, AI is used for fraud detection, risk management, and algorithmic trading. AI algorithms can analyze transaction data in real-time to identify suspicious activity and prevent fraudulent transactions. Similarly, in supply chain management, AI can optimize logistics, predict demand, and minimize disruptions. For example, AI can analyze weather patterns, traffic conditions, and other factors to optimize delivery routes and ensure timely delivery of goods. In retail, AI is used to personalize shopping experiences, optimize pricing, and manage inventory. AI-powered recommendation systems can suggest products that customers are likely to be interested in, based on their past purchases and browsing history. Moreover, decision AI is being used in autonomous vehicles to make real-time driving decisions. AI algorithms analyze sensor data to detect obstacles, navigate traffic, and ensure the safety of passengers. The Challenges and Limitations
Now, it's not all sunshine and rainbows. Decision artificial intelligence also comes with its own set of challenges and limitations. One of the biggest challenges is data quality. AI algorithms are only as good as the data they're trained on. If the data is incomplete, inaccurate, or biased, the AI system will likely make poor decisions.
Another challenge is the lack of transparency. AI algorithms can be complex and difficult to understand, making it hard to know why they made a particular decision. This lack of transparency can be a problem in situations where accountability is important, such as in legal or ethical contexts. Additionally, decision AI systems can be vulnerable to manipulation. Adversarial attacks, where malicious actors intentionally try to trick the AI system into making the wrong decision, are a growing concern. To mitigate these risks, it's important to implement robust security measures and regularly audit the AI system's performance. Furthermore, the ethical implications of decision AI need to be carefully considered. AI systems can perpetuate and amplify existing biases if they are not designed and trained properly. It's crucial to ensure that AI systems are fair, unbiased, and aligned with human values. This requires careful attention to data collection, algorithm design, and ongoing monitoring. One exciting trend is the development of more explainable AI (XAI). XAI aims to make AI algorithms more transparent and understandable, allowing humans to better understand why they made a particular decision. This will be crucial for building trust in AI systems and ensuring accountability. Another trend is the integration of AI with other technologies, such as the Internet of Things (IoT) and blockchain. This will enable new applications and use cases for decision AI, such as smart cities, autonomous supply chains, and decentralized decision-making. Moreover, as AI becomes more pervasive, we can expect to see new ethical and regulatory frameworks emerge. These frameworks will aim to ensure that AI is used responsibly and ethically, protecting human rights and promoting societal well-being.
